Why do ionization energy and electronegativity have the same trend? Ionization Energy and Electronegativity: The ionization energy of an atom is the amount of energy needed to remove an outer shell (valence) electron from the ground state electron configuration of an atom Electronegativity is a relative measure of an atom's attraction for electrons shared in a bond with another atom Answer and Explanation: 1
